Worst Bakers in America - Season 1

Season 1
Episodes

Bakingfail
The new recruits learn that boot camp is no cakewalk; Duff Goldman and Lorraine Pascale have the recruits bake something inspired by pictures and recipes from the internet; chefs go back to basics with a sugar cookie recipe.

Trick or Treat?
Duff Goldman and Lorraine Pascale taste some terrifying baked goods at the Halloween-themed boot camp; recruits must create scary cake pops to impress trick-or-treaters and put Halloween candy to good use as they bake some surprise-inside cupcakes.

For the Love of Baking!
Duff Goldman and Lorraine Pascale host a boot camp for brides and grooms; the contestants sculpt wedding cake toppers; the recruits go head to head and bake a four-layer celebration cake; the couple in last place gets sent home.

The County Fair
The recruits arrive at boot camp with a county fair underway; Duff Goldman and Lorraine Pascale judge the recruits' creations in a blind tasting; in the main baking challenge, the recruits go nuts for doughnuts.

Best in Show
A week away from the $25,000 prize, the recruits strive to impress Duff Goldman and Lorraine Pascale with their knowledge of pastries; YouTube star Ashley Adams teaches the recruits to make animal shaped eclairs; puppies serve as cake models.

Bakery Battle
The final two recruits must take over a bakery and bake for a panel of baking experts; Duff Goldman and Lorraine Pascale serve as mentors as their recruits put their skills to the test; one recruit will be named the winner and take home $25,000.
